The Big Three: Who Dominates the Market?
The German drugstore market is greatly combined, controlled by three significant chains. While they share similarities, each has its own distinct character, house brand names, and shopping experience.

Necessary Tips for Shopping in a German Drogerie
Shopping in Germany features a couple of unwritten rules and cultural quirks. Keep these tips in mind to make sure a smooth journey:
- Bring Your Own Bags: Germany takes ecological sustainability seriously. Bags are never ever complimentary, and cashiers anticipate shoppers to pack their own items quickly. Keep a collapsible tote bag (Jutebeutel) in your knapsack or handbag.
- Download the Apps: Both dm and Rossmann have great mobile apps. They offer digital vouchers, commitment points (like Payback at dm or Rossmann App deals), and digital invoices. Scanning the app at checkout can yield huge cost savings.
- The "Pfand" System: While mostly associated with beverage bottles, some specialized eco-cleaning products or particular natural drink brand names offered in drugstores also bring a deposit (Pfand) system.
- Cash vs. Card: While Germany is notoriously slower at adopting cashless payments than the rest of Europe, significant pharmacy chains now commonly accept EC cards, credit cards, Apple Pay, and Google Pay. However, keeping a 1-euro coin handy for the shopping cart (Einkaufswagen) is constantly an excellent concept.
Beyond Beauty: The Hidden Gems
A typical mistake made by newbie visitors is dealing with the Drogerie solely as an appeal supply store. In truth, these stores are mini-hypermarkets.
- The Organic Food Aisle (dmBio/ EnerBio): Stocked with organic oats, nuts, protein bars, teas, infant food, and vegan snacks that are typically considerably more affordable than standard supermarket.
- Family & & Cleaning Supplies: From environment-friendly laundry detergents to powerful descaling representatives (essential for Germany's tough faucet water), the cleaning aisles are top-tier.
- First Aid and Pharmacy Basics: While prescription drugs require a Apotheke (pharmacy), pharmacies stock basic non-prescription items like vitamins, organic teas, pain reducers, plasters, and eye drops.
